Brain Dead Dinner - Skillet Potatoes

Ingredients List
- 1/2 Bag Cascadian country style
- Potatoes (frozen mix of
- Potatoes,
- Peppers, and onions)
- 1 Apple juice (small amount)
- 3 sl Yves Canadian Bacon (veggie
- & nonfat),
- 1 pk Hain fatfree gravy mix
Directions
Chop up the Canadian Bacon slices into bite size pieces.
Heat apple juice in nonstick skillet. Add enough potatoes to more or less
form one layer. Sprinkle the chopped up canadian bacon on top. Stir/turn
over a couple of times, several minutes apart, to prevent excess sticking
(I like crisp potatoes so I let it stick a bit).
While potatoes are cooking, mix up gravy mix (I was so brain damaged I just
microwaved some leftover gravy that I found in the fridge :-), pour over
potatoes to taste and eat.
Some good bread to sop up the gravy would be a plus. Next time I'll add
some other frozen veggies.
